Harira Soup
Harira soup is a traditional Moroccan dish, aromatic and full of flavor. It is very easy to prepare and perfect for sharing with the whole family during the colder months.

Ingredients
-
28
oz
Mutti Polpa - Crushed Tomatoes
-
1
generous tablespoon
Mutti Double Concentrated Tomato Paste
-
14
oz
pre-cooked chickpeas
-
1/2
cup
dried lentils
-
1
onion
-
1
celery stalk
-
1/2
cup
fresh cilantro
-
1/2
cup
parsley
-
1
teaspoon
turmeric
-
1
teaspoon
ground ginger
-
1/2
lemon
-
as needed
Vegetable broth or water
-
3
tablespoons
extra virgin olive oil
-
t.t.
salt
-
t.t.
pepper

Harira Soup: Method
- In a large pot, gently sauté the finely chopped onion and celery, then add the lentils and let them toast for a few minutes.
- Now add the Mutti Crushed Tomatoes and the Tomato Paste, the chickpeas, the spices, and the chopped cilantro and parsley, and mix well.
- Add salt and pepper to taste, then pour in enough vegetable broth or water to just cover the soup.
- Cover with a lid and cook over low heat for at least one hour, stirring occasionally.
- Once ready, add the juice of half a lemon to the soup and mix well.
- Serve the harira soup garnished with a few cilantro leaves and lemon slices.
